War Uncertainty Drives Eurozone Shoppers to Pause

European Central Bank (ECB) researchers have found that the ongoing war in the Middle East has led to a significant pullback in Eurozone shoppers. According to an economic bulletin published on Monday, households with disposable income are choosing to delay discretionary purchases due to uncertainty about the future.

The slowdown in 'nominal consumption' is being driven by higher-income households who can afford to spend but are opting for caution instead. This pattern suggests that the current economic downturn is more of a confidence-driven shock rather than a straightforward cost-of-living squeeze.

ECB researchers pointed out that consumer confidence fell by 12 points between February and April, with spending momentum 'softening materially'. Essentials such as housing and food expenditures remained relatively stable, while transport costs pushed up nominal energy spending. The fact that lower-income households adjusted their spending less than higher-income ones further supports the notion of a confidence-driven slowdown.

The ECB's findings have implications for businesses in the Eurozone, particularly those reliant on discretionary consumer spending. While the current downturn may be stop-start and prone to sudden pauses and rebounds, it also means that demand can quickly pick up if uncertainty fades.
